Atrium Health Mercy is a full-service community hospital, specializing in the care of seniors and in complex foot and ankle surgery, hip and knee surgery, bariatric surgery, and women's pelvic health. Atrium Health Mercy is Magnet certified in Nursing Excellence and is also a Planetree certified, patient-centered hospital. The Planetree model is committed to enhancing health care from the patient's perspective; empowers patients and families by providing information and education, cultivates healing of the mind-body-spirit, provides patient-directed care, is value-based, holistic and promotes safety of patients through active involvement in their own care. As a Planetree Certified facility, we focus on the following:-Connect values, strategies, and action-Implement practices that promote partnership-Use evidence to drive improvement-Create organizational structures that promote engagement  Job Summary Serves as a role model, consultant, change agent and facilitator in the assessment, planning, implementation and evaluation of orientation and educational programs with the Division of Nursing. Functions in a variety of settings to develop and maintain the competency of nurses who care for individuals and groups with physical disability and chronic illness. Assesses initial and ongoing learning needs, plans and implements programs to meet these needs, and evaluates the outcomes of plans on the learner, the organization, and patient care. Essential Functions Collaborates with nursing leadership to assess needs for orientation and continuing education needs for nursing team. Develops and conducts facility specific orientation for licensed and non-licensed nursing team. Facilitates 30 day new employee orientation and 90 day reunion sessions as part of the facility service excellence initiatives. Designs programs that enhance the practice of nursing; assists the learner to comply with licensure and certification requirements. Coordinates with Nurse Managers to place students, orient students, and organize preceptorships for undergraduate and graduate students. Utilizes adult education principles, plans, designs, and implements educational activities based on identified learning needs. Works as a program Planner.
